The significance of each college football conference championship game

Conference championship weekend has arrived, with nine conferences set to crown their champions across Friday and Saturday. Four titles will be determined on Friday, while the remaining five will be settled the next day. Here's a breakdown of whats on the line for each matchup.

Sun Belt Championship: James Madison vs. Troy

Game Details: Troy at No. 25 James Madison, Bridgeforth Stadium/Zane Showker Field, VA, Troy +23.5, O/U 46.5

Troy: The Trojans aim for their ninth conference title and third in five seasons. After consecutive Sun Belt titles in 2022 and 2023, Troy enters as heavy underdogs against James Madison. They earned their spot in the title game following wins over Georgia State and Southern Miss, despite late-season losses to Arkansas State and Old Dominion.

James Madison: JMUs defense is among the strongest outside the Power Five, allowing only 4.2 yards per play and 16 points per game. A decisive win could solidify their status and impact College Football Playoff rankings, especially if Duke wins the ACC title.

Conference USA Championship: Kennesaw State vs. Jacksonville State

Game Details: Kennesaw State at Jacksonville State, AmFirst Stadium, AL, Kennesaw State -2.5, O/U 60.5

Kennesaw State: After a 2-10 debut FBS season, the Owls are 9-3 and competing for a conference title in just their second year at this level. Their only regular-season loss to Jacksonville State sets up a rematch for the championship.

Jacksonville State: The Gamecocks aim for their third consecutive nine-win season and back-to-back CUSA titles under coach Charles Kelly, maintaining dominance since transitioning to FBS.

American Athletic Conference Championship: North Texas vs. Tulane

Game Details: No. 24 North Texas at No. 20 Tulane, Yulman Stadium, LA, North Texas -2.5, O/U 66.5

North Texas: Both teams are vying for a College Football Playoff berth. The Mean Green, leading the nation in scoring, have won six straight games by multiple possessions since their season-opening loss to South Florida. Coach Eric Morris heads to Oklahoma State after the season.

Tulane: The Green Wave, riding a four-game winning streak, benefit from key wins over Duke and Ole Miss. Quarterback Jake Retzlaff leads the team in both passing and rushing touchdowns.

Mountain West Championship: UNLV vs. Boise State

Game Details: UNLV at Boise State, Albertsons Stadium, ID, UNLV +4.5, O/U 58.5

UNLV: The Rebels aim for their second conference title in school history and a rare 11-win season, continuing the momentum of back-to-back 10-win campaigns.

Boise State: Seeking consecutive Mountain West titles, Boise State faces its final chance for a conference championship before moving to the Pac-12 in 2026.

Big 12 Championship: BYU vs. Texas Tech

Game Details: No. 11 BYU vs. No. 4 Texas Tech, AT&T Stadium, TX, BYU +12.5, O/U 49.5

BYU: A win secures BYUs first College Football Playoff appearance and their first conference title since 2007, capping a historic week for the program.

Texas Tech: Ranked No. 4 in the CFP, a loss likely won't affect Techs playoff spot, but a victory could lead to a first-round bye and a Cotton Bowl berth.

MAC Championship: Miami (Ohio) vs. Western Michigan

Game Details: Miami (OH) vs. Western Michigan, Ford Field, MI, W. Michigan -1.5, O/U 43.5

Miami (Ohio): The RedHawks aim for a second title in three years, overcoming a season with a mix of tiebreakers and key victories to reach the championship game.

Western Michigan: The Broncos are one win away from matching their 2016 success, seeking just their second 10-win season in program history with a potential bowl win to follow.

SEC Championship: Georgia vs. Alabama

Game Details: No. 3 Georgia vs. No. 9 Alabama, Mercedes-Benz Stadium, GA, Georgia -2.5, O/U 47.5

Georgia: A win guarantees a first-round bye in the playoff and a third SEC title in four years, extending Kirby Smarts impressive run of consistent success.

Alabama: Victory secures a playoff spot, while a loss could jeopardize their position depending on BYUs performance, creating a potential scenario where Alabama falls out of the playoff.

Big Ten Championship: Ohio State vs. Indiana

Game Details: No. 1 Ohio State vs. No. 2 Indiana, Lucas Oil Stadium, IN, Indiana +4, O/U 47.5

Ohio State: Winning ensures the No. 1 seed in the playoff and a trip to the Rose Bowl, keeping alive the chance for a historic 16-0 season.

Indiana: For a program with limited football history, a Big Ten title marks a monumental achievement under coach Curt Cignetti, showcasing Indiana at the top of the conference.

ACC Championship: Duke vs. Virginia

Game Details: Duke vs. No. 17 Virginia, Bank of America Stadium, NC, Duke +4.5, O/U 57.5

Duke: A win could shake up the 12-team College Football Playoff, demonstrating that any team now has a chance in the expanded format. Duke has struggled in non-conference play but seeks a marquee upset.

Virginia: Victory would cap an exceptional season, matching their total wins over the first three years of Tony Elliotts tenure and potentially securing a playoff berth. Their last conference title came in 1995.
